3个核心技术彻底释放genshin-fps-unlock工具性能:从原理到实战优化指南
【免费下载链接】genshin-fps-unlockunlocks the 60 fps cap项目地址: https://gitcode.com/gh_mirrors/ge/genshin-fps-unlock
在高刷新率显示器普及的今天,60FPS的游戏体验已无法满足玩家需求。genshin-fps-unlock作为一款专业的帧率解锁工具,能够突破原神游戏的帧率限制,让硬件性能得到充分发挥。本文将从核心原理、环境适配、场景方案、高级应用到问题解决,全面解析如何优化使用这款工具,让你的游戏体验更上一层楼。
一、核心原理:揭开帧率解锁的神秘面纱
当你在游戏中设置144FPS却始终无法突破60FPS时,是否曾疑惑帧率限制究竟藏在哪里?genshin-fps-unlock工具就像一位"数字锁匠",能够精准找到并修改游戏内存中的帧率控制参数。
1.1 内存写入技术:像修改文档一样调整游戏参数
工具采用内存写入技术(WriteProcessMemory)实现帧率解锁,这一过程可以类比为"在不关闭文档的情况下修改其中的特定数字"。当游戏运行时,所有参数都存储在计算机内存中,工具通过精准定位帧率限制参数的内存地址,将默认的60FPS数值修改为用户设定值。这一过程不会对游戏核心文件造成任何修改,就像在阅读电子书时添加批注一样,关闭后不会改变原文件内容。
在技术实现上,工具首先以调试模式附加到游戏进程(类似医生为病人做检查),然后通过特征码扫描找到存储帧率限制的内存地址(如同在一本厚书中找到特定页码),接着使用WriteProcessMemory函数修改该地址的值(就像涂改液覆盖旧数字),最后持续监控该地址防止游戏重置参数(类似设置闹钟提醒防止遗忘)。
1.2 进程通信机制:工具与游戏的"对话"方式
工具与游戏进程之间通过Windows API进行通信,这种通信方式可以比喻为"两个人通过对讲机交流"。工具作为主动方,不断向游戏进程发送查询和修改指令,而游戏进程则被动接受这些指令。这种设计的优势在于不需要修改游戏本身的代码,所有操作都在运行时动态完成,大大降低了被检测的风险。
核心要点:genshin-fps-unlock通过内存写入技术动态修改游戏参数,无需修改游戏文件,具有安全、可逆的特点。其工作流程包括进程附着、内存定位、值修改和实时监控四个步骤,就像一位精准的"数字医生"为游戏"诊断"并"治疗"帧率限制问题。
二、环境适配:打造稳定运行的基础
你是否遇到过工具启动失败或游戏崩溃的情况?这很可能是环境配置不当造成的。就像开车前需要检查车况一样,使用genshin-fps-unlock前也需要确保系统环境满足基本要求。
2.1 系统环境检查:你的电脑准备好了吗?
运行genshin-fps-unlock需要以下系统环境:
- 操作系统需为Windows 10 20H2或更高版本的64位系统(就像开车需要合适的道路条件)
- 需安装.NET Desktop Runtime 8.0.0或更高版本(相当于游戏的运行"引擎")
- 处理器需为x86_64架构并支持SSE4.2指令集(如同汽车需要合适的发动机)
检查这些环境的方法很简单:在命令提示符中输入dotnet --version可以查看.NET版本;按下Win+R键输入winver可以查看系统版本;而wmic cpu get Name命令则能显示处理器信息。如果发现版本不满足要求,需要先更新系统或安装必要的运行时组件,否则工具可能无法正常工作。
2.2 工具获取与准备:正确的"装备"很重要
获取工具的官方渠道是通过GitCode仓库,你可以使用git clone https://gitcode.com/gh_mirrors/ge/genshin-fps-unlock命令克隆仓库到本地。如果不想自己编译,也可以在发布页面下载已编译的可执行文件。需要注意的是,工具文件应放置在除游戏文件夹外的任意位置,这就像给汽车加油时要使用专用油枪一样,避免与游戏文件产生冲突。
核心要点:环境适配是工具稳定运行的基础,包括检查系统版本、.NET运行时和硬件支持。获取工具时应通过官方渠道,文件存放位置需避开游戏目录。做好这些准备工作,可以大幅降低使用过程中出现问题的概率,为后续优化打下良好基础。
三、场景方案:为不同设备定制最佳配置
不同的硬件设备和使用场景需要不同的帧率设置,就像不同的车型适合不同的路况一样。genshin-fps-unlock提供了丰富的配置选项,让你能够根据自己的设备情况定制最佳方案。
3.1 笔记本电脑:平衡性能与续航的艺术
使用笔记本电脑玩游戏时,你是否经常面临性能与续航的两难选择?当电池供电时,高帧率会显著缩短续航时间,而低帧率又影响游戏体验。针对这种情况,建议将目标帧率设置在75-90FPS之间,这个区间既能保证游戏流畅度,又不会过度消耗电量。
具体操作方法是在启动工具时添加电池保护参数:.\GenshinFPSUnlocker.exe --battery-save --fps 85。这条命令会启用电池保护模式,并将帧率限制在85FPS。需要注意的是,使用电池供电时,即使设置了较高帧率,实际表现也可能因为硬件降频而打折扣,因此合理的预期管理也很重要。
3.2 台式机:释放极致性能的设置
对于高性能台式机用户来说,如何充分发挥硬件潜力是首要考虑的问题。如果你拥有144Hz或更高刷新率的显示器,可以尝试将目标帧率设置为144-240FPS。例如使用命令.\GenshinFPSUnlocker.exe --max-fps 165 --priority high,这条命令将帧率上限设为165FPS,并将游戏进程优先级提升至高级,让系统资源优先满足游戏需求。
需要注意的是,过高的帧率设置可能导致显卡温度过高,建议同时监控硬件温度,确保在安全范围内运行。此外,部分高端显示器支持动态刷新率技术,可以配合工具使用,在保证流畅度的同时减少功耗。
3.3 移动设备:触控优化的特殊配置
对于Steam Deck等移动设备或触控屏笔记本,genshin-fps-unlock提供了专门的移动UI模式。启用这一模式的命令是.\GenshinFPSUnlocker.exe --mobile-mode --fps 90 --touch-optimize。该命令会将帧率设置为90FPS,并优化触控区域和界面布局,使游戏更适合触控操作。
移动设备通常散热条件有限,因此帧率不宜设置过高,90FPS是兼顾流畅度和发热控制的理想选择。同时,使用移动模式时建议配合设备的性能模式,以获得最佳体验。
核心要点:不同设备需要不同的配置方案。笔记本用户应平衡性能与续航,台式机用户可追求高帧率体验,移动设备则需考虑触控优化和散热限制。通过合理使用命令参数,可以为每种场景定制最佳配置,充分发挥工具的灵活性。
四、高级应用:挖掘工具的隐藏潜力
掌握了基础使用方法后,你可能想进一步挖掘工具的高级功能。genshin-fps-unlock提供了多种高级选项,让你能够更精细地控制游戏性能。
4.1 多显示器设置:为每个屏幕定制帧率
如果你使用多显示器 setup,工具可以根据游戏窗口所在屏幕自动调整帧率。例如,主显示器是144Hz游戏屏,而副显示器是60Hz办公屏,你可以使用命令.\GenshinFPSUnlocker.exe --multi-display --display 1:144 --display 2:60来为不同显示器设置不同帧率。当游戏窗口在显示器之间移动时,工具会自动切换对应的帧率设置,就像智能调节的"双温区空调"。
使用这一功能时,需要确保工具能够正确识别显示器编号,你可以通过Windows显示设置查看每个显示器的序号。此外,不同显示器的刷新率差异较大时,切换过程中可能出现短暂卡顿,这是正常现象。
4.2 性能监测:找出游戏的"瓶颈"
要想进一步优化游戏性能,首先需要了解当前的性能瓶颈在哪里。工具提供了内置的性能监测功能,通过命令.\GenshinFPSUnlocker.exe --monitor可以启动监测界面。这个功能就像汽车的仪表盘,实时显示帧率、CPU和GPU使用率等关键指标。
根据监测结果,你可以判断性能瓶颈类型:如果GPU使用率持续接近100%而CPU使用率较低,则说明是GPU瓶颈;反之则是CPU瓶颈。针对GPU瓶颈,可以适当降低游戏画质设置;而CPU瓶颈则可能需要关闭后台程序或升级硬件。
4.3 配置文件管理:个性化设置的备份与恢复
如果你在不同场景下需要不同的配置方案,可以使用工具的配置导出导入功能。例如,使用.\GenshinFPSUnlocker.exe --export-config "gaming-profile.json"命令可以将当前配置导出到文件,需要时再用--import-config命令导入。这一功能就像游戏存档一样,让你可以快速切换不同的设置方案。
建议定期备份配置文件,特别是在游戏或工具更新前,这样可以在出现问题时快速恢复到稳定配置。配置文件中包含了所有参数设置,包括帧率限制、优先级、显示设置等,是个性化设置的重要保障。
核心要点:高级应用功能让工具更加灵活和强大。多显示器设置可以为不同屏幕定制帧率,性能监测帮助定位瓶颈,配置文件管理则方便个性化设置的备份与恢复。合理使用这些高级功能,可以进一步提升游戏体验,满足不同场景下的需求。
五、问题解决:常见故障的诊断与修复
即使是最稳定的工具也可能遇到问题,遇到故障时不必慌张,大多数问题都有明确的解决方案。就像医生诊断疾病一样,通过系统的排查方法,你可以快速定位并解决问题。
5.1 工具无法找到游戏进程:连接问题的解决
当工具提示"找不到游戏进程"时,首先要确认游戏是否已通过官方启动器正常安装。如果游戏路径发生变化,工具可能无法通过注册表找到游戏。这时可以手动指定游戏路径,使用命令.\GenshinFPSUnlocker.exe --game-path "C:\Program Files\Genshin Impact Game\YuanShen.exe",将路径替换为你实际的游戏安装位置。
另一个常见原因是杀毒软件阻止了工具对游戏进程的访问。你可以尝试将工具添加到杀毒软件的白名单,或者暂时关闭实时保护功能。需要注意的是,仅从官方渠道获取的工具才是安全的,第三方修改版可能包含恶意代码。
5.2 解锁后出现画面撕裂:流畅与稳定的平衡
画面撕裂是高帧率游戏中常见的问题,通常是由于显卡输出帧率与显示器刷新率不同步导致的。解决这一问题有两种方法:一是启用显卡控制面板中的垂直同步功能,二是使用工具的帧率平滑选项。
使用工具解决的命令是.\GenshinFPSUnlocker.exe --smooth-fps --vsync auto。这条命令会启用帧率平滑技术,并根据当前帧率自动调整垂直同步设置。需要注意的是,垂直同步可能会增加输入延迟,对于竞技类游戏玩家来说需要权衡取舍。
5.3 游戏更新后工具失效:版本兼容问题
游戏更新后,帧率限制的内存地址可能发生变化,导致工具失效。这时首先要检查工具是否有更新版本,通常开发者会在游戏更新后尽快发布兼容版本。你可以使用.\GenshinFPSUnlocker.exe --check-update命令检查更新,或直接访问项目仓库查看最新动态。
如果暂时没有更新,也可以尝试手动调整内存扫描参数,但这需要一定的技术知识。对于普通用户,建议等待官方更新,避免因参数设置错误导致游戏异常。
核心要点:常见问题包括进程查找失败、画面撕裂和版本兼容问题。解决这些问题的关键是:确认游戏路径和权限设置,合理使用垂直同步和帧率平滑功能,及时更新工具版本。遇到问题时,建议先查看工具文档或社区讨论,大多数常见问题都有成熟的解决方案。
通过本文介绍的核心原理、环境适配、场景方案、高级应用和问题解决方法,你已经掌握了优化genshin-fps-unlock工具的全面知识。记住,最佳配置没有统一标准,需要根据自己的硬件条件和使用习惯不断调整。希望这些技术解析和实操指南能帮助你彻底释放工具潜能,享受更流畅的游戏体验!
【免费下载链接】genshin-fps-unlockunlocks the 60 fps cap项目地址: https://gitcode.com/gh_mirrors/ge/genshin-fps-unlock
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考